Abstract :
To solve the difficulty in the quantitative evaluation of communication support effectiveness, in this paper, an effectiveness evaluation model is proposed based on the analytic hierarchy process (AHP) and combination weighting approach, and examples of verification are given. The study indicates that this model can be used to objectively and effectively evaluate the comprehensive support effectiveness of a communication system, and to guide the follow-up supports.
